2 things on seeds. First the covering on a seed needs to split before it is finished. Sounds like your seeds are nice and brown so you shouldn't have a problem there. Second seeds should be dried for 2 months before you try and geminate them. I am not sure how much this matters it is just a general rule of thumb. It doesn't sound like you do that. It may matter so you should keep it in mind.

What you mentioned is called grafting. I know it works for lots of different fruits and vegetables. I am sure others have tried it with marijuana before. The fact that you don't see it done regularly today means something. I don't know what. Maybe they don't mix when you do it. It might just be to hard to do. There is a reason though. Nothing hurts with trying it.

With the pulpy center on marijuana stims I would make the cuts on both plants low were it may be more woody.
